7th CPC Pay Hike for State Government employees – Cabinet to decide today
The Tamil Nadu cabinet is all set to meet today, October 11, 2017, to decide on the issue of wage increment for the state government employees and teachers.
The Tamil Nadu Government had decided to revise the pay scale for the state employees and teachers based on the Seventh Pay Commission for the Central Government employees. A special committee was constituted for recommending the required changes. The committee met the Chief Minister Edappadi K. Palanisamy on September 27 and gave its recommendations.
The cabinet will meet today at 11.15 AM at the Secretariat, to decide the salary increment percentage, based on the recommendations. All the ministers will participate in this meeting, to be chaired by the chief minister. Official announcements regarding wage increments will be made at the end of the meeting.
